๐ AI Impact Analysis
With a risk score of 40/100, Computer Occupations, All Other faces moderate automation pressure. While tasks like generative ai producing marketing and creative copy are increasingly handled by AI, the role retains significant human elements. The 439,380 workers in this occupation should focus on strengthening skills in architecting novel systems requiring creative problem-solving and stakeholder negotiation and requirements elicitation to stay ahead. The role will likely evolve rather than disappear.

๐ O*NET Task Profile
Monitor systems for intrusions or denial of service attacks, and report security breaches to appropriate personnel.
Identify or document backup or recovery plans.
Back up or modify applications and related data to provide for disaster recovery.
Correct testing-identified problems, or recommend actions for their resolution.
Identify, standardize, and communicate levels of access and security.
